In india 80% of cement plants are located closed to mines (10 kM). 15% of cement plants are located in the range of 20-30 km from limestone mines & 5% of cement plants are located more than 40 km from limestine mines.

WhatsApp: +86 18221755073Limestone mining in East Jaintia Hills, Meghalaya, India is being carried out extensively for the production of cement. Extraction of limestone is done mainly by adopting opencast method of mining. Mining activities have deteriorated the environment of the area in terms of deforestation, biodiversity loss, water quality and availability, noise ...

WhatsApp: +86 18221755073Mine-head closing stocks of limestone for the year 2019-20 was 23.44 million tonnes as against 22.49 million tonnes in the previous year. Average daily labour employment in limestone mines in 2019-20 was 19,836 as against 21,633 in the previous year. LIMESTONE AND OTHER CALCAREOUS MATERIALS

WhatsApp: +86 18221755073Limestone, composed mostly of calcium carbonate, is used primarily to produce Portland cement for the building industry. Other products that use limestone include breakfast cereal, paint, calcium supplements, antacid tablets, paper and white roofing materials.
